Description

DJD XXXII presents the first full critical edition of the Great Isaiah Scroll (1QIsa]a) and the Hebrew University Isaiah Scroll (1QIsa]b), which constitute almost 30% of all the preserved biblical material, in the styles of the DJD series.

That is, whereas the photographs and transcriptions have been available since the 1950s, this volume provides a fresh transcription of all the known fragments, notes clarifying problematic readings, and the first comprehensive catalogue of the textual variants.

It is not, and cannot be, a comprehensive analysis of all these highly influential manuscripts, on which innumerable studies have been published over the past half century.

Part 1 contains the photographic plates (1QIsa]a in colour) with the transcriptions on facing pages for easy comparison.

Part 2 contains the introductions, notes, and catalogue of variants.

The main introduction narrates the discovery and early history of these two manuscripts.
